The support group will provide friendships with people that know and understand exactly what you and your family are going through. Together you can share your happy times, your sad times, your frustrations, your fears and generally help with the loneliness and isolation you can sometimes feel. Just knowing that you are not the only one who has this condition can be a tremendous relief.
The group is a place where experiences, research and treatment can be shared and discussed, helping group members to learn more about this syndrome.
We also aim to promote a greater understanding, education and awareness of Fibromyalgia both in the community and amongst medical professionals on the island.
By helping to educate people on what Fibromyalgia is and how it affects people in their everyday life then it will hopefully make learning to live with the condition easier.
People such as family, friends, carers, employers, work colleagues, nurses, doctors etc. need to know in order to provide the best help and support.
We organise guest speakers, awareness events and social get-togethers. We also produce an in-house Newsletter on a regular basis to help keep people informed.

 

 

Why join a support group? It can be comforting to have the reassurance, understanding and support of others who share the same challenges that you have to face.
